Cristiano Ronaldo has just broken up with his longtime girlfriend, stunning model Irina Shayk, but it looks like the eligible bachelor is already back in the dating pool. Rumors claim that the Real Madrid superstar is now romantically attached with another model.   

According to a report from Latin Times, Ronaldo is now rumored to be dating Televisa Deportes reporter and Mexican model Vanessa Huppenkothen, as stated by a translated report from Diez Minutos.

The news outlet reported that Ronaldo and Huppenkothen are "not official yet," but speculations say that the Portuguese footballer "fell for the Mexican beauty following her visit to Spain," where the TV presenter was promoting a new betting service.

Huppenkothen was married to Juan Fernández Recamier from 2011 to 2013. Their divorce was due to Huppenkothen's alleged affair with co-host Miguel Gurwitz, which the two both denied, Latin Times wrote.

After the World Cup 2014, the Mexican beauty announced that she was dating someone. In an interview back in August 2014, she said, "Life really just puts things in its place, you don't have to be looking and it arrives when you least expected," the news outlet quoted.

She added, "I don't know if I am in love, but I am very hopeful. The smile has returned to Vanessa and the feeling of completeness and goodness."

Huppenkothen didn't reveal the identity of her new flame back then, but she insisted that he wasn't from Mexico and that "him being far away and only being able to see each other on occasion makes it much more interesting," Latin Times noted.

It was in January when Ronaldo announced that his relationship with Shayk had already ended. He said, "After dating for five years, my relationship with Irina Shayk has come to an end. We believed it would be best for both of us to take this step now. I wish Irina the greatest happiness," Daily Mail reported.

The news outlet noted that the split could be attributed to a heated argument between Shayk and Ronaldo's mother.

There have been many speculations about the breakup, especially when Shayk unfollowed the Real Madrid striker on Twitter, days before Ronaldo's official announcement. Daily Mail also noted that Shayk was absent during Ronaldo's third Ballon d'Or win celebration held on January 12. Filling up the model's absence, however, was sports journalist Lucia Villalon, who was linked to the football star at that time.

Villalon is reportedly a huge fan of Ronaldo's successful career in sports. Daily Mail reported that she watched from the stands during Real Madrid's game against Getafe CF on January 18, cheering him on with a couple of friends.
